W18Cr4V钢激光相变强化层的磨损试验研究

Research on the Wear Resisting Property of Laser Strengthened Layer of W18Cr4V Steel

【摘要】 研究了W18Cr4V高速钢激光相变强化层的组织、耐磨性及磨损机理。试验结果表明:强化层的强韧化及其表面残余压应力的存在使其耐磨性提高了1~11倍;经640℃回火后强化层的硬度和韧性得到了进一步的改善,其耐磨性又提高了1~2倍。由磨面形貌分析可知强化层是以塑性变形引起的犁沟方式磨损的。

【Abstract】 The structure,wear resistance and wear mechanism of laser strengthened layer of W18Cr4V high speed steel were researched in this paper.Experimental results show that the strengthening and toughening effects and the residual compressive stress of the laser strengthened layer make the wear resistance increase by 1~11 times. Since the strength and the toughness of the layers tempered at 640℃ are improved further,the wear resistance is 1~2 times more than that of the untempered layers.The worn surface morphology analysis shows that the wear of laser strengthened layers follows the plough trenches way caused by plastic deformation.
